     849  0 Kommentare SPYRUS Announces Latest FIPS 140-2 Level 3 Certification to USB 3.0 SSD Product Line for Windows To Go and Secure Encrypted Storage

    SAN JOSE, CA--(Marketwired - Jul 25, 2016) - SPYRUS, Inc. today announced the release of NIST Certificate 2685 for the SPYRUS USB 3.0 Module, which includes members of the Microsoft (NASDAQ: MSFT) certified Windows To Go family; WorkSafe Pro, WorkSafe, Secure Portable Workplace, Portable Workplace, and P-3X secure data storage products. This comprehensive certification adds information security to the MIL-810 tested packaging which provides an unprecedented selection of capabilities and features in sizes from 32 GB through 512 GB with 1 TB soon to be released for General Availability. For the Microsoft ecosystem, these products bring a new dimension to the world of Windows 8.1, Windows 10, and Windows To Go operations. In particular, the SPYRUS Windows To Go offerings enhance the endpoint and secure mobility capabilities of smaller enterprises taking advantage of the Windows 10 Enterprise E3 subscription service that provides Windows 10 and management services for smaller enterprises lacking IT infrastructures. The certification is also extended to the WTG Xtreme family which takes an evolutionary leap forward by allowing multiple processing environments with their own independent operational profiles on the same drive. Strong cryptographic separation ensures a high assurance environment to prevent data leakage between the domains and profiles.

    The newly certified product family of USB 3.0 SSD drives maintains compatibility with the optional SPYRUS Enterprise Management System (SEMS). Combining a Microsoft public key with a smart card-enabled ecosystem and SPYRUS security applications extends a true end-to-end security approach for enterprise smart card and PKI infrastructure to mobile users. With SEMS device management, enterprise administrators can centrally register, block/unblock, revoke, set policies, audit, and "kill" the USB 3.0 drives. The latest versions of SEM 4.5 feature active directory integration and support for globally distributed domains and privileges. SPYRUS SEMSaaS allows enterprises to employ a "cloud based SEMS" without standing up their own servers.
